At EuroFinance Copenhagen, GTR caught up with Vanessa Manning, Europe product head at Standard Chartered, to discuss the most promising innovations in the trade finance space.

She mentioned cloud-based platforms as a significant development, since corporates are increasingly moving away from banks’ proprietary solutions and towards “bank-agnostic” platforms.

In terms of blockchain technology, Manning explained that current use cases are being tested in the document authentication arena, but that use cases in the payment space is widely possible in the future.

Finally, she sees the relationship between banks and fintechs evolve more and more towards collaboration, as fintechs allow banks to bring new solutions to market much more quickly than if they developed them in-house.
